
森のせせらぎ なごみ
豊かな緑の中に自然石を散りばめた、風情あふれる露天風呂が自慢。豊富なメニューの食事処や広々とした畳の休憩処で、湯上がりも大満足だ。美容界のパイオニア、山野愛子プロデュースの本格エステも併設。

JR東鷲宮駅のすぐ近くにある温泉施設。平成10年(1998)に57℃、湧出量毎分1000リットルの埼玉県内では最高温の温泉が自噴。以来、仮設の施設で営業したのち、平成14年(2002)に全面改装された。ウッド調と石造り風の2カ所の浴場は、湯船2槽とサウナ付きの大浴場、2段の岩風呂があり、週ごとの男女交替制。いずれも美肌効果もあるといわれる源泉をかけ流しで使用している。個室5室(3時間5400円)も温泉浴槽付きだ。
れっきとしたフツーの酒屋さんなのだが、全国より鉄道むすめファン、萌えファンの集う聖地。話題の「萌え酒」の品揃えも豊富。店員さんもあたたかく迎えてくれる、一度は訪れてみたい店。

Starting from Lake Kamikita in the town of Mōroyama, there are approximately 11km in total length and a 6-hour hiking trail for the healthy family, connecting Kitamou Jizo ~ Monomiyama ~ Hidaka City Takashiyama ~ Hiwadayama ~ Hiwadayama ~ Hiwadayama ~ Hiwadayama Pass ~ Iinono City. It was developed to allow you to enjoy the seasonal nature while walking slowly, passing through the forest of cedar and cypress, enjoying the coppice forest, the clear stream of the Koryo River, and the idyllic landscape of the countryside, leaving the remnants of Musashino, and walking by visiting the ancient shrine. The vantage from Mount Mono at an altitude of 375m is exceptional.
A wooden bell tower that stands on the street from the first city street into the bell. It was reportedly built by the owner of Kawagoe Castle, Tadakatsu Sakai, during the Kanei years (1624-44). It was converted at the order of Nobunaka Matsudaira in the second year (1653). The current tower, which is 16.2m high and built with a cypress, was rebuilt after the Great Fire of Meiji 26 (1893). It is an electric type and tells the time four times every day: 6 o'clock, 12 o'clock, 15 o'clock and 18 o'clock.
